Megan Joy looks forward to tour's Utah stop
Utahn Megan Joy, who placed No. 9 in the past season of "American Idol," says she is looking forward to performing on the tour, especially at the E Center.
"I have always hoped I would have this kind of opportunity to sing for my friends and family," Megan Joy said during an interview with the Deseret News. "I can't believe that I will be able to do this."
Megan Joy is the latest Utahn to go on the "American Idol" tour. Murray's David Archuleta placed second last year in the TV singing competition.
Megan Joy of Sandy said the concert will showcase all of the performers.
"Those who finished in the Top 10, but not the Top 2, will get to do two solos and then a group number," Megan Joy said. "The top winners will get to play longer."
Still, Megan Joy, who cited Mariah Carey and Bjork as her vocal influences, said she was overwhelmed at the prospect of touring with the group on a cross-country jaunt from Portland, Ore., to Manchester, N.H. The tour lasts from July to mid-September.
"When I think about it, I get a little nervous," she said, with a shaky laugh. "But I have always wanted to have a career in entertainment and this is a good start."
Megan Joy is joining the other season 8 "American Idol" contestants — winner Kris Allen, runner-up Adam Lambert, Allison Iraheta, Anoop Desai, Danny Gokey, Lil Rounds, Matt Giraud, Michael Sarver and Scott MacIntyre.
"It's exciting to know that I'm going to be on tour with these people who have become my friends," she said. "They have become like my family."
Speaking of family, Megan Joy said she will miss her 2-year-old son Ryder while she is on tour.
Still, Megan Joy said, "American Idol" has been a big help for her financially in supporting her son.
"Thanks to my appearance on the program, I know that I can take care of my son by myself," she said.
During her most famous appearance on "American Idol," where contestants paid tribute to Michael Jackson a few months before his death, Megan Joy sang "Rockin' Robin" and interjected a "Caw Caw" at the end of her performance.
"I did the 'caws' on the spur of the moment," she said with a laugh. "Ever since I was a kid, I liked doing animal noises. And I felt that since the song was 'Rockin' Robin,' a bird sound would be funny."
Megan Joy said she plans to tune into the next season of "American Idol" every now and then.
"But I really don't have a lot of time," she said.
When she was in Salt Lake City in May, she went with her sister to give a little assembly at her sister's high school in Taylorsville.
